Children and young people living in public care are often perceived as victims or troublemakers – stereotypes reinforced by negative images promoted in the media. For young people in care the reality is very different. There are stories of ambition and talent, potential and determination, achievement and happiness. And there are many stories of young people succeeding in spite of the difficulties they have experienced.

Let’s Get Positive is a practical guide to developing a media campaign which challenges negative images of young people in care and promotes positive stories. The guide will help users to develop and take forward a media campaign. It provides advice on working effectively with the media and includes good practice case studies. It also includes an information kit which can be given to journalists.
